Output 89f4cf19d7697fccc2abdabf6ecccd3753f06c49eee3da88e888d4941eb82bf3:2

value
17000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bde73ad59e2e1bb7e4181241fc539a0547b477e OP_EQUAL
address
32mmqt1mnFdiErcv6cua4NhKzwk8heTUmM
transaction
89f4cf19d7697fccc2abdabf6ecccd3753f06c49eee3da88e888d4941eb82bf3
confirmations
34757
spent
true